San Francisco 49ers ($3,900) 

An expensive play, yet the 49ers get a home game against QB Taylor Heinicke, who has been sacked 8 times over his last two contests. Since claiming the starting gig in Washington, Heinicke has thrown 5 INTs in 8 games and been sacked 17 times total. Enter the 49ers, who rank 9th in sacks and 11th in pressure rate (QB hurries + knockdowns + all sack plays). Heinicke is going to want an ice bath for Christmas after this game. 

Baltimore Ravens ($3,200)

The Ravens have been tough defensively this season since acquiring LB Roquan Smith from the Bears. Baltimore has given up the 4th-fewest passing yards and the 5th-fewest in points allowed. Now, the Ravens get a home game against rookie Desmond Ridder. Ridder was sacked four times last week against the Saints and passed for less than 100 yards. Naturally, Falcons HC Arthur Smith is going to try to use the run game to help Ridder, but the Ravens excel against the run as well. The Ravens have given up the 3rd-fewest rushing yards this season as well as the 3rd-fewest rushing yards per attempt. Fire up the Ravens defense in cash this week.

RB- Nick Chubb ($7,700) or Kareem Hunt ($4,900)

The Cleveland Browns love to run the ball. In fact, the Browns have run at the 9th-highest rate (49.1%) in the NFL this season. This should play nicely into their matchup with the Saints, who are the 8th-best True Matchup for RBs. RB Tyler Allgeier dusted the Saints’ defense for 139 yards and 1 TD last week. If Chubb can’t go because of his foot injury, Hunt will have tremendous value.

Philadelphia Eagles ($2,200)

The Eagles rank 3rd in pressure percentage at 24.6% and QB Dak Prescott has struggled mightily lately. Dak has thrown 7 INTs and been sacked 13 times in his last four games. If the Eagles can stop the Dallas rushing attack, Dak will be under siege all afternoon.
